The replacement of a single pane within double-glazed windows can cost between PS55 and PS145 based on the size and style. It is usually cheaper to repair a broken window. However, you should always get a professional opinion before deciding whether you want to replace your windows or not.

If you have a double-glazed windows that has a misty appearance it could be a sign of a leak between the glass panes or a problem with the seal. It can be solved using a specialized repair process which removes the moisture, cleans the glass unit and then installs a new spacer bar and desiccant in order to stop future condensation. This repair can be done at home or in a shop and is typically less expensive than replacing the whole window.

Replacing damaged double panes is the most cost-effective solution, but it's not always feasible to replace just the glass. Double-pane windows have a gap between the two glass panes which is sealed with argon gas or Krypton gas to form an airtight seal and reduce the loss of energy. To ensure energy efficiency, and to ensure an airtight seal, it is usually required to replace the entire window if a single glass pane breaks.

Misted Double Glazing

Misted double glazing is a major issue for homeowners. It can affect how well your windows function, and can result in dampness, mold and expensive energy bills. It is essential to address any double glazing issues as soon as you can, especially as winter approaches.

When the glass in your windows gets condensation between the panes, this is referred to as misting. It is typically due to poor installation or air infiltration. The best method to avoid this is to utilize the FENSA controlled window installer.

Double glazing owners frequently report that their windows and doors are difficult to open and close after installation. This can sometimes be caused by extreme temperatures as the frame expands or shrinks depending on the weather. It's worth trying to warm up or cool down the frame by using hot or cold water, and adjust any hinges, handles or mechanisms. If this doesn't work you, you might want to contact the company that installed your double glazing. They might offer a repair service or a full refund.

If your double-glazed windows have started to mist this could indicate that the seal between the two panes of glass has failed. There are many reasons for this, such as old age, poor installation or the use of harsh cleaners or oils. It is recommended to use an FENSA certified installer to ensure that your double glazing is in full compliance with UK building regulations.

In certain instances, you can repair the double-glazing unit that is misted by replacing the bars that hold the spacers with ones that are a little warmer. This will prevent condensation by raising the temperature of the glass. Alternatively, you can use thermally efficient glass with low emission coatings and argon gas between the glass to reduce condensation.

Window Repair

Double-paned windows are an excellent option to shield your home from the elements and improve the efficiency of your HVAC system. Your windows will eventually experience problems, and it's crucial to know when to replace or repair them.

If you notice a build-up of dirt, fogging, or moisture it could be an indication that your window's seal has failed. The seals stop air from escaping between the two panes of glass in your insulated glass unit (IGU).

This could lead to your window becoming less energy efficient and resulting in higher energy bills. It may be necessary to replace the entire window or just the glass, depending on the severity of the problem.

In some instances, a professional can perform an effective window repair to fix the issue. It is possible to clean the area, repair the seal, or apply some silicone or putty. This will prevent the seal from becoming shattered and will allow your window to function normally again.

Skylight Repair

Skylights are an excellent way to bring natural light into a house without making it too bright. They also work well to add insulation which will help to reduce heating costs. Like all windows and doors, they may experience a variety of issues. It is crucial to seek out a professional when an un-double-pane skylight becomes damaged. This will prevent condensation, water leaks and other damage to the frame and glass.

Skylight leaks are usually caused by the deterioration of the seal on the glass or the frame corrosion. These problems can cause water to leak from the frame into the ceiling. A contractor can fix a skylight leak by sealing or replacing the flashing seal, and frame. The cost of repairing a skylight varies depending on the size of the window and the type of glass. If the frame is severely damaged, it may be worth replacing it.

Mold is another common problem with skylights. The mold can be seen on the outside of the windows, inside the frame or on the inside of the glass. It could be caused by condensation, leaky pipes or a faulty seal. If the mold is limited to the area around the window, it can be removed by simple repairs. If the mold is widespread, the skylight may need to be replaced.
